  1. History

    • The English aristocracy established the English country decor style a few centuries back when they escaped to the country for weekend fox hunts and polo matches. But the aristocrats weren't alone. Their gardeners and the farmers who lived in the countryside lived in smaller cottages, and those houses and interiors have become part of the English country decor style as well.

    Furniture

    • Furnishings typically found in English country homes are Queen Anne or Victorian, but one is not limited to these styles to create an English country look. Any furniture with similar lines in pine, oak or painted wood will work. Upholstered pieces are generally overstuffed and comfortable, covered in floral print fabrics.

    Features

    • Curtains in English country homes are often either floral-printed chintz or lace. Floors are usually hardwoods covered with Oriental rugs. Prints or paintings on the walls are of English country gardens, croquet or polo matches, fox hunts, favorite horses or hunting dogs. Accent pieces include brass lamps, horse sculptures, brass or pewter pieces, pitchers or teapots filled with roses, vintage hats on hat stands and walking sticks.

    Outdoors

    • English country roses are featured both outside and inside English country homes. Outside, they might wind around a trellis and up cottage walls. The interior roses are found more in bouquets and in the printed fabrics of pillows, table skirts, and sofas and chairs. English-style gardens are found adjacent to the larger English country homes. A croquet set that is all set up and ready to play adds to the effect.

    Effects

    • The English country style can be as formal as that found inside English country manors or as casual as that found in the cottages of English farmers. Either is a correct interpretation of the style.
